Genesis 28:5

5And Isaac sent away Jacob: and he went to Padan-aram unto Laban, son of Bethuel the Syrian, the brother of Rebekah, Jacob’s and Esau’s mother.

Genesis 28:6

6¶ When Esau saw that Isaac had blessed Jacob, and sent him away to Padan-aram, to take him a wife from thence; and that as he blessed him he gave him a charge, saying, Thou shalt not take a wife of the daughters of Canaan;

Genesis 28:7

7And that Jacob obeyed his father and his mother, and was gone to Padan-aram;

Genesis 28:8

8And Esau seeing that the daughters of Canaan pleased not Isaac his father;
